Disability Ramp Repair in Denver, CO
Disability ramp repair services focus on restoring safety, accessibility, and functionality to existing ramps on residential properties. These projects typically involve fixing structural issues, repairing or replacing damaged surfaces, and ensuring the ramp meets safety standards for ease of use. Homeowners often request these services when their current ramps have become unstable, worn, or unsafe due to weather, age, or regular use, aiming to maintain a secure entryway for individuals with mobility challenges.
Property owners should consider the condition of their existing ramps and any specific accessibility needs before requesting repair services. It’s important to assess whether the ramp’s dimensions, slope, and surface condition comply with safety guidelines and accommodate the user’s mobility requirements. Understanding the scope of repairs needed and the overall condition of the ramp can help determine the most appropriate approach to restore safe access and ensure long-term durability.

Common Disability Ramp Repair Jobs
Disability Ramp Repairs - services include fixing and restoring existing ramps for safe accessibility.
Ramp Replacement - involves removing old or damaged ramps and installing new, compliant structures.
Slope Adjustments - ensures ramps meet proper incline requirements for ease of use.
Handrail Installation - adds or repairs handrails to improve safety and support on ramps.
Surface Resurfacing - revitalizes worn or uneven ramp surfaces for better traction and safety.
Structural Reinforcement - strengthens ramp frameworks to ensure durability and stability.
Disability Ramp Repair Questions
What types of damage require ramp repair? Damage such as cracks, warping, or loose components can affect safety and accessibility, indicating the need for repair.
How can I tell if my ramp needs repair? Visible issues like uneven surfaces, corrosion, or missing parts are signs that a ramp may need attention.
Are repairs necessary for safety compliance? Yes, maintaining a secure and stable ramp is important to meet safety standards and ensure safe access.
What common issues are addressed in ramp repair services? Repairs often include fixing structural damage, replacing worn components, and restoring proper slope and stability.
